Home
last modified time | relevance | path

Searched refs:ReifiedJniTypeTrait (Results 1 – 2 of 2) sorted by relevance

/libnativehelper/include_platform_header_only/nativehelper/detail/
Dsignature_checker.h714 struct ReifiedJniTypeTrait { struct
722 static constexpr ReifiedJniTypeTrait Reify() { in Reify() argument
743 static constexpr ConstexprOptional<ReifiedJniTypeTrait>
748 operator==(const ReifiedJniTypeTrait& lhs, const ReifiedJniTypeTrait& rhs) {
756 inline std::ostream& operator<<(std::ostream& os, const ReifiedJniTypeTrait& rjtt) {
802 constexpr ConstexprOptional<ReifiedJniTypeTrait> in DEFINE_JNI_TYPE_TRAIT()
803 ReifiedJniTypeTrait::MostSimilarTypeDescriptor(ConstexprStringView type_descriptor) { in DEFINE_JNI_TYPE_TRAIT()
1090 constexpr ReifiedJniTypeTrait operator()() const {
1091 auto res = ReifiedJniTypeTrait::Reify<T>();
1099 using ReifiedJniSignature = FunctionSignatureDescriptor<ReifiedJniTypeTrait,
[all …]
/libnativehelper/tests/
DJniSafeRegisterNativeMethods_test.cpp616 ReifiedJniTypeTrait::Reify<derived>()); \
619 ReifiedJniTypeTrait::Reify<derived>())); \
674 constexpr auto res = ReifiedJniTypeTrait::MostSimilarTypeDescriptor(type_desc); \
675 EXPECT_TRUE((ReifiedJniTypeTrait::MostSimilarTypeDescriptor(type_desc)).has_value()); \
676 if (res.has_value()) EXPECT_EQ(ReifiedJniTypeTrait::Reify<type>(), res.value()); \
681 auto res = ReifiedJniTypeTrait::MostSimilarTypeDescriptor(type_desc); \